The brim - Just received this hat yesterday (thanks desertcart Prime for free 2-day shipping). CONSTRUCTION / MATERIALS: This hat appears to be very well made. The two-piece crown has black cloth tape wrapping the inside seam so if your head happens to bump it it's not scratchy. The back seam does not, but it lays flat and didn't seem to be a problem. All the stitching seems good. The brim, being made of a stitched layer of both the solid material underneath and the mesh topside, is pretty rigid; it flexes but seems to return to shape. The mesh sides crush but also seem to return to shape; repeated crushing might eventually cause rippling. The crown comes with a nice, moderate dent on top, and due to the crown's construction, it seems like it will hold this shape. STYLE: I wanted a ventilated hat that offers more shade from the sun than a ball cap, yet doesn't look like a floppy gardening hat, and this fits the bill. Resembling a fedora, it's more stylish than most casual hats but not overly dressy. The leather chinstrap with wooden bead gives it a western touch without being a full-on cowboy hat. You won't really be able to shape this hat with your own pinches, dents, brim curls, etc., but why would you want to... it's already a nice shape, and probably the best shape for doing its job of keeping the sun off your face, neck and ears. VENTILATION: The mesh lets in plenty of air; I can feel a breeze through it even just walking through the house. The sweatband was comfortable but felt a little warm, so any sweating from wearing this hat would be caused there. COLOR: The "Earth" color is a nice medium brown just like the photo (at least on my screen); pretty neutral, not chocolate brown but also not orangey or reddish. Due to the color variations in the canvas weave of the top / band / brim edging, I can see this hat matching a variety of medium-brown-shaded clothing well. The solid top and mesh sides of the crown match color with each other probably better than the picture shows. Some of the other color choices for this hat almost made it look two-toned, and I didn't want that. The reason for the apparent shade variation between the two pieces is probably more due to the fact that the holes in the mesh make the side look darker, while the solid top piece reflects more light. To test, I put a piece of white paper behind the mesh; the mesh and canvas looked almost identical in color. Can't say for the other color options, but Earth's materials are close enough to not be an obnoxious contrast. SIZING: This is my only regret, but unless you order hats with true hat sizes it's always going to be a guess. I ordered the XL based on Henschel's size comparison chart. I measured my head circumference at 23-1/2". Maybe I measured at the wrong spot or angle, or maybe Henschel's sizes vary from hat to hat, but this one is snug on me. I can wear it, but all-day wear might be uncomfortable. If it relaxes after some wearing, I'll be OK; but if it shrinks even a bit, I'm in trouble. I probably measured my head wrong, because a 7-3/4 usually fits comfortably if not a little loose. I think I'll reorder as an XXL, and put some narrow padding behind the sweatband. Find a chart that compares circumference with hat sizes alongside S/M/L sizes to get a good idea. OTHER: The bead seems to hold its place, but I'd definitely put a knot in the chinstrap below the bead to avoid losing it. OVERALL: This is a great casual hat that provides excellent ventilation and good shade from the sun. Measure your head carefully; if you're between sizes, go up. Fits about as expected, look is great, winner brim, Khaki, Large for 22 & 7/8 works
Been wearing "similar" hats for a lot of years (~20), but of what I'd call now a cheaper variety. Probably have bought more than 10 of those, similar style hats. They're lighter weight, but i was pestered by the brim which would bend up/down in the breeze. This is a much stiffer brim, and as a result is also a bit heavier, though the weight was not a problem for me. The stiffness of the brim is key and really adds to the wearability. The strap is a bit shorter than I'd like, but I removed the knots where it enters the brim as well as moved the knot at the ends of the strap to be as low down as possible. I like to button the strap into my shirt so a wind from behind doesn't send it flying, and yet I can just throw it off the back of my head and the strap doesn't rest on my neck. Breeze moves well through the mesh, and on muggy days the sweat has not yet bled through the brim. Will be buying a 2nd to keep a bit more pristine for travel, etc. Have not tested the recovery from crushing, but will try to report back when I do. Packaging was a bit flimsy in a substantially crushed box with a bit of a crush on the hat, but it seems to have survived fine. This style hat was a godsend when I discovered it 20 yrs ago, and this is a very nice implementation of it! My head measured 22.875" and the Large stated it was for 23". It's fairly loose to my head, but stays put in the wind and is comfortable.

I rated this hat based on my comparison to the best hat I've ever tried on, in terms of workmanship, etc. -- if you want to spend a bundle there are superior hats for that budget, at least in terms of hats you'll wear for life. If I had rated it based on the value, I would have given it 5 stars. This hat is certainly light and perfect for summer. It seems very well constructed and my guess is it will be more than durable enough to outlive any reasonable expectations. I am usually a size 7 1/4 and my head measurement is 22.75 inches, so I used Henschels size chart http://www.henschelhats.com/new/sizing/ to order a large. It is a teeny bit roomy in circumference but I'm sure it looks better overall than a Medium would have (better too big than too small), so I am happy. I might search for one of those inserts that go inside where the sweat band is. This is a great-looking hat and the brim is styled just right for sun protection and a classy "Aussie" vs. Western look. It is not at all "floppy" but it not as stiff as the ones with wiring. If I were to "crush" it when I packed it, I would lay it down crown up and flatten just the crown rather than bend or roll it. Others have mentioned putting socks or tee shirts in the crown which seems ideal. I wouldn't hesitate to buy it again and I may just order another one in a different color. Worth every penny
If you look back in reviews you will find my past reviews of this hat. It's made in several flavors, both here and abroad. I have both. This is the foreign made one, and it has a slightly smaller brim. I believe 3 inch compared to 3 1/2. It's the same material, and oddly as it may seem I feel the quality is a bit better. My first one was bought at an airshow and I wore it daily for years. I watched it get stolen on live video and couldn't do anything about it. Next I bought the pricey American made one, and never liked it quite as much. The top of the hat just doesn't sit correctly in line with the rest of the hat, and the brim is a bit larger. Recently I decided to get a lighter colored one and purchased this. Ahh, my well loved hat is back in a different color. Happy camper. As far as crushproof goes I ha0ve tested the limits with my past ones, shoved into corners and behind headrests in hot trucks, smashed flat in a backpack. It always comes back to shape and without a wire in the brim I don't have to mess with it. With its mesh sides and solid top and generous brim it feels light and even in darker colors I feel cooler. It's one great hat. Unless you have a real need for the wider brim I think (my opinion) the 3 inch is better proportioned. Either way. It a good hat and you'll be happy.
